A young British woman has shared her transformative experience of leaving her bustling life in the UK to live on a remote island in New Zealand. At just 22 years old, Catrin made the bold decision to relocate from the resort town of Malvern to the isolated Motutapu Island in the Hauraki Gulf. Her journey began in 2022 when she sought adventure and a lifestyle distinct from the fast pace of her previous environment.

Motutapu Island, located off the coast of Auckland, is accessible only by a single ferry service that operates once a week, connecting the island to the downtown ferry terminal. This limited access contributes to the island’s serene and secluded atmosphere. Catrin found herself among a small community of residents, living with only a handful of others for nine months.

Life on the Island

For Catrin, living on Motutapu Island was a stark contrast to her life in Malvern. The island’s tranquil surroundings provided her with an opportunity to connect with nature and reflect on her aspirations. Catrin embraced the simplicity of island life, engaging in various activities such as gardening, birdwatching, and hiking the island’s scenic trails.

The experience also offered her a chance to forge meaningful relationships with fellow residents. The close-knit community fostered a supportive environment, allowing her to share her journey with others who had also chosen to leave their previous lives behind. Catrin described this sense of camaraderie as a vital aspect of her time on the island, highlighting the importance of human connection in such a remote setting.

Challenges and Rewards

While Catrin enjoyed the beauty of Motutapu, she faced challenges typical of island living. The remoteness meant limited access to supplies and amenities, requiring her to adapt her lifestyle accordingly. She learned to be resourceful, often relying on the island’s natural resources for her needs.

Despite these challenges, Catrin found the experience rewarding. She developed a deeper appreciation for nature and a stronger sense of self. Her time on Motutapu Island allowed her to reflect on her goals and priorities, leading to personal growth that she considers invaluable.
